Default Air Filter on MB

I just installed the ADA Billet Air Filter on my TRAXXAS Monster Buggy:

http://www.davesmotors.com/store/product1265.html

Cleaning the filter is not going to be as simple as unscrewing the face plate and removing the three filters, so I am wondering how often I should take it apart to clean the whole thing. It has a metal plate with tiny holes, a fine green filter and a thicker red sponge filter, plus I am also using an Outerwears Airfilter Pre-Filter:

http://www.davesmotors.com/store/product324.html

If I did not have to remove the tank and part of the roll cage just to get the filter plate off, I would not worry about it, but I do. Should I remove everything and clean it after every run, clean it every gallon or so, or will the condition of the prefilter be a good enough indication of the interior filters? None of the parts of the filter are designed to use filter oil, so this is kind of new to me. Any opinions?
